Principal People Business Partner

SoFi is a next-generation financial services company and national bank that is transforming personal finance. The Principal People Business Partner will serve as a strategic advisor to senior leaders, aligning people strategies with business objectives and leading initiatives to foster a high-performing culture within the Independent Risk Management & Compliance team.

Responsibilities

Serve as a trusted advisor to Risk and Compliance leaders, shaping and executing people strategies that align with business goals to enable high performing and engaged teams
Diagnose root cause organizational and talent challenges, develop scalable and innovative solutions, and lead execution to drive sustainable business outcomes
Provide executive-level coaching to leaders on leadership effectiveness, performance, team dynamics, and change management
Address highly ambiguous organizational challenges and drive large-scale initiatives to shape the future of the organization, ensuring clear communication and leader readiness
Use people analytics and business data to inform decision-making, anticipate future organizational needs, identify trends and risks, and proactively improve organizational health and performance
Balance employee and business needs by providing expert guidance on employment practices, maintaining up-to-date knowledge of legal requirements and ensuring a fair, compliant, and supportive workplace
You make it easy for the business to work with the people team, simplifying programs, weaving the people strategy throughout multiple touchpoints to drive intended business outcomes through people programs with tailored business knowledge
Partner with and mentor People Business Partners, supporting their professional growth, capability development, and effectiveness as strategic advisors
Work closely with People Team Centers of Excellence and HR Business Partners to design and deliver integrated people programs that drive measurable impact for the business
